Our Surprise Engagement Party!

October 9th, 2007 @ 3:13 pm by Mrs. Daffodil

My best friend is the BESTEST! Mr. D and I went to Atlanta for a wedding this weekend and we stayed with our friends, Amy and Reid. Amy is one of my bridesmaids and my best friend since middle school. To our surprise, the next morning, we woke up to a surprise engagement party! It was so incredibly special for us because our entire wedding party is spread out all over the US, so Mr. D and I never even had a chance to celebrate our engagement in person with any of our friends…until now!

What we both found most surprising, however, was how much more “official” we felt afterwards.  It’s not that our engagement didn’t feel official before, but for some reason, having it acknowledged in this manner really made us realize “wow, this is for real!”  It was the perfect timing as well, as we are getting close to six months til the wedding…Wedding planning will really be picking up at this point, so it was the perfect kickoff to this season in our lives!
